Tim and Janet were divorced.Their only marital property was a personal residence with a value of $100,000 and cost of $40,000.Under the terms of the divorce agreement,Janet would receive the house and Janet would pay Tim $10,000 each year for 5 years,or until Tim's death,whichever should occur first.Tim and Janet lived apart when the payments were made to Tim.The divorce agreement did not contain the word "alimony."

Abraham Maslow
A psychologist known for creating Maslow's hierarchy of needs, a theory in psychology proposing a five-tier model of human needs, from physiological to self-actualization.
